Unsupervised and supervised compression with principal component analysis in wireless sensor networks

This paper shows that the Principal Component Analysis, a compression method widely used in statistical anaylsis and image processing, can be efficiently implemented in a network of wireless sensors. The proposed scheme proves to be particularly suitable to sensor networks as it allows to reduce the network load while retaining a maximum amount of variance from sensor measurements. We present two operating modes, unsupervised and supervised, allowing (i) to extract a maximum of variance while keeping the network load bounded, and (ii) to reduce the network load while keeping the approximation error bounded, respectively. We assess the efficiency of the proposed approach in a realistic wireless sensor network deployment for temperature monitoring.
